WebFeb 7, 2011 · It seems that a command like: cd subdir # works via interactive bash; not in script run via sh. will work as expected in my interactive login shell, bash, even when CDPATH is set. However, when I run the identical command in a script (using sh ), it failed with. myscript.sh: line 9: cd: subdir: No such file or directory. WebNope, there isn't a way to cd to a directory that only allows root without being root. There really shouldn't be too many directories that have this limitation. Most of the time it's the access to a given file that's limited such as the /etc/shadow file or specific log files under /var/log. You can use sudo ls
ubuntu - Why can
WebThe directory will require the execute bit set in order for you to enter it. I don't know what you tested, but you cannot enter a directory without the execute bit, or read files in it: $ mkdir foo $ echo "baz" > foo/bar $ chmod 660 foo $ cd foo bash: cd: foo: Permission denied $ cat foo/bar cat: foo/bar: Permission denied WebA little bit of clarification: In the example above both root (the user) and root (the group) have the execute bit set. So members of the group root can cd into www. User david cannot cd because he is not included in the root group members. You can inspect that by viewing … Stack Exchange network consists of 181 Q&A communities including Stack … can t contact seller on amazon
Cannot cd into a directory, no visible problem - linux
WebFeb 19, 2024 · These may override the "basic" permissions. Check with sudo getfacl pathname for each directory. As for the s bit on group, it means that the files/subdirs created in directory will have group set to directory's group regardless of who creates them. You can remove this with sudo chmod g-s pathname. @Ray i meant su - gitlab … WebJun 11, 2014 · Jun 11, 2014 at 8:45. 'cd' works in a shell script. For example, you might have placed any script onto /home/alex/Documents/A/B/C path and you write shell script like: first it will go to the directory (via cd) then run the script (via ./) then it will. However, after that control will return back to the current path from where you are running ... WebWrite (w) Anyone can create or delete files in the directory. Execute (x) Anyone can change (cd) into the directory and access files in that directory by name (such as Web page … flashbacks fe2